Arson fire burns Denver house, leaves at least one person hospitalized

An arson fire burned in a single-family house and garage just north of Washington Park early Wednesday, leaving one person injured.

Firefighters raced to the fire near the intersection of South Downing Street and East Alameda Avenue and were dousing flames shortly after midnight.

Denver police also responded and were assisting firefighters in the investigation of what happened, according to an agency posting on Twitter.

The person was hospitalized, police said. It was unclear whether other residents of the house suffered injuries.
